What are common causes of truck accidents in California?

While every case is different and accidents can be caused by a number of different factors, here are some of the more common causes of truck accidents caused by truck drivers:

  • Inadequate training
  • Systems of compensation that encourage faster speeds and more consecutive hours of driving
  • Unrealistic schedules and expectations

If one of these was the cause of a truck accident you were in, then you may want to pursue a lawsuit against the truck company. The truck company may be considered negligent and be liable for your damages.

However, there are also times when a car is at fault for a truck accident. Some common causes of accidents committed by car drivers are:

  • Driving in the no-zones where there’s little visibility to truck drivers
  • Changing lanes abruptly
  • Going to the right of a truck when the truck is turning right
  • Misjudging an approaching truck’s speed
  • Merging improperly into traffic
  • Failure to slow down when a truck begins to change lanes
  • Unsafe passing
  • Driving between large trucks
  • Abandoning a vehicle in a travel lane

Even if the accident was your fault, there may be a way for you to still recover damages. This is because of California’s comparative fault law. This means that if the accidents is deemed partially your fault, you can still receive partial recovery. Working with a lawyer will help you with the fight to prove fault. What kind of compensation can I receive from a truck accident suit?

Our lawyers will always fight for you to win as much compensation as possible in your case. In truck accident cases, you are usually able to recover compensatory damages. Some examples of compensatory damages are:

  • Medical bills
  • Lost wages
  • Pain and suffering
  • Car repair or replacement
  • Disfigurement
  • Loss of consortium

This is not an all-inclusive list, and speaking with one of our lawyers is the best way to see how much your case could be worth. In a small amount of cases, you may also be able to recover punitive damages. These are awarded when someone has acted especially malicious. How can I preserve evidence after an accident?

The best way to preserve evidence after a truck accident is to photograph everything. If you are able to, make sure you photograph all your property damages, the scene itself, road condition, your injuries, and anything else that is relevant. The more visual proof you can provide, the better our lawyer will be able to determine what you should do with your case. All your photographs are just a few of the things that you should bring to an initial consultation. It will also be in your interest to bring copies of the accident report, medical bills, and witness and other party information. All of this will help your lawyer give you accurate and helpful legal advice.
